After 6 years together, Maria is cleaved up with over Skype by Matias. This leads her world to get into a tailspin for she had adapted and then much to him being happy and thus them happy she has prepare aside a lot. One of the chief things existence her writing. Making it so, later tears and a bit of alcohol, she finds herself again. Though, not without the ghost of Matias haunting her.
Luckily, thank you to a roommate named Carolina, her male best friend Santiago, and all-time friend – period – Natalia, she gathers the strength to movement on.

Highlights
It's Rooted In Such A Way A Lot of Romance Films Aren't
Maria (Gisela Ponce de Leon)
While Maria is noted to be someone lucky enough to inherit a overnice business firm, it is established that maintaining that house is so expensive she pretty much has to alive with someone. That and rely on cheap labor whenever possible. So while it pushes her slightly into a privileged part, they make sure she seems more then lucky than another posh girl with human relationship problems.
Which you lot terminate up thankful for because Maria is the kind of graphic symbol you could easily identify with. She is merely the right amount of dramatic when it comes to her breakdown and how she handles information technology doesn't brand yous cringe just retrieve, "I've been at that place girl." Specially equally she is dealing with her memories, thoughts of Matias haunting her, and the manner he sort of plays with her emotions to the point of coming off similar an f*** boy.
It doesn't end there though. Natalia, Maria's best friend, is dealing with comparing where her life is to her rival, and to compete with her professionally, she sacrificed her personal life. I'm talking, despite how flirtatious Santiago is with her, she just curves him. All in an effort to get in ahead because she has calls in China, and so much going on that she'd have to work at being with someone.
Giving united states quite a few characters that, if you can't identify with them, you lot know someone just like them and feel the need to signal out someone to say, "Hey, meet that? That'due south you correct at that place. Larn from this!"
On The Fence
It Drags Subsequently Awhile – Probably Because No One Has That Notable Personality
Caroline (Jely Reategui): At that place's a full moon today, people become weird.
Having relatable, perhaps what can be considered normal, characters comes as a double-edged sword. On i paw, y'all can relate to Maria and Natalia's issues, including Maria having a bigot for a boss, depending on your situation. Yet, if you lot can't chronicle to them, even if you bring in Carolina, Maria's eccentric roommate, y'all may find yourself bored with this movie.
Especially since at that place aren't whatever real deep conversations or moments which just hit you in the gut. Nosotros only get tiny revelations which are good enough for you to appreciate, only certainly don't leave yous in awe. This includes Carolina trying to coddle Maria equally Natalia keeps it a little flake likewise existent.
Overall: Mixed (Divisive)
The best thing well-nigh How To Go Over a Breakup is also arguably its worse. With keeping the movie without theatrics, lacking advice that seems also perfect to just randomly come out someone's mouth, and u.s. seeing people just slowly abound, the movie can seem boring. Making yous really feel the 8 or so months the movie covers in an hour and a half.
Hence the mixed characterization. In the constant pursuit of balancing out the everyday woman with what is needed to brand an exciting feature, How To Get Over a Breakup possibly goes to what may be considered an extreme. Something which some may appreciate while others may see information technology as defective the kind of oomph which yous tin commit to for ninety minutes.
